Ellie Goulding wants 'I Need Your Love' to be her next single

  • December 5, 2012
  • Brad O'Mance

Ellie Goulding would quite like her next single to be her Calvin Harris col­lab­or­a­tion, 'I Need Your Love'.

Pretty risky, right?

Chatting to MTV about all sorts, she said: "I'm hoping [the next single] will be the song with Calvin Harris, 'I Need Your Love' it's called, and I love it so much, we wrote it together."

She's a real musician you see.

Mind you, she's also aware that it may never see the light of day in America given that they won't stop bloody playing 'Lights'.

"But I don't know, 'Lights' just won't go away, so I have to wait for that to happen," she continued. "I know, I know. Poor me."
